Thin Film Transistor Array Substrate and Electronic Device Including the Same
Provided are a thin film transistor army substrate and an electronic device including the same. The thin film transistor army substrate includes a first active layer disposed on a substrate, a first gate insulating film disposed on the first active layer, a first gate electrode disposed on the first gate insulating film to overlap a part of the first active layer, a first insulating film disposed on the first gate electrode, a second active layer disposed on the first insulating film to overlap the first active layer and the first gate electrode, a second gate insulating film disposed on the second active layer, and a second gate electrode disposed on the second gate insulating film to overlap a part of the second active layer. The first gate electrode and the second gate electrode overlap each other, and thus it is possible to reduce an area occupied by transistors.
ELECTRONIC DEVICE AND METHOD OF MANUFACTURING THE SAME
A method of manufacturing an electronic device is provided. The method includes the following steps: providing a substrate; forming a thin-film transistor layer on the substrate; forming a first passivation layer on the substrate; forming an organic layer on the substrate; patterning the organic layer to expose a first region; forming a second passivation layer on the substrate; patterning the first passivation layer to expose a second region; forming a bonding pad on the substrate, wherein the bonding pad corresponds to an overlapping area of the first region and the second region; and bonding an electronic component to the bonding pad. An electronic device manufactured by the method is also provided.

Oxide semiconductor field effect transistor
An oxide semiconductor field effect transistor (OSFET) includes a first insulating layer, a source, a drain, a U-shaped channel layer and a metal gate. The first insulating layer is disposed on a substrate. The source and the drain are disposed in the first insulating layer. The U-shaped channel layer is sandwiched by the source and the drain. The metal gate is disposed on the U-shaped channel layer, wherein the U-shaped channel layer includes at least an oxide semiconductor layer. The present invention also provides a method for forming said oxide semiconductor field effect transistor.

FABRICATION OF HIGH MOBILITY THIN FILM TRANSISTORS ON THIN AND FLEXIBLE CERAMIC SUBSTRATE
A method for making a thin film transistor device includes forming a semiconductor film on a flexible substrate comprising a thin ribbon of refractory material that does not degrade when heated to temperatures greater than about 750° C. The semiconductor film is crystallized by heating the semiconductor film and the flexible substrate to at least about 750° C. A dielectric material is deposited on the crystallized semiconductor film. Gate, source, and drain electrodes are formed on the dielectric material.
Semiconductor device and method for manufacturing the same
A semiconductor device with low parasitic capacitance is provided. The semiconductor device includes a first oxide insulator, an oxide semiconductor, a second oxide insulator, a gate insulating layer, a gate electrode layer, source and drain electrode layers and an insulating layer. The oxide semiconductor includes first to fifth regions. The first region overlaps with the source electrode layer. The second region overlaps with the drain electrode layer. The third region overlaps with the gate electrode layer. The fourth region is between the first region and the third region. The fifth region is between the second region and the third region. The fourth region and the fifth region each contain an element N (N is hydrogen, nitrogen, helium, neon, argon, krypton, or xenon). A top surface of the insulating layer is positioned at a lower level than top surfaces of the source and drain electrode layers.
